Team,

Starting next Monday, the Quillhaven payroll export switches from fixed-width to delimited records with an explicit currency column. Downstream consumers at Fernbrook Accounting have confirmed readiness. Please validate any custom parsers against the staging feed before the cutover window. The candidate build that produced the sample files is identified below.

pipeline stamp: htk9_6ce9d33c5

## Local Setup

Clone the scanhub-edge repo and install deps with `make bootstrap`. The Zelquist barcode SDK mock runs on port 7311; start it via `make mock-scanner` before tests. Scan events persist to the local inventory DB, so Postgres must be running. Point the service at it using the following:

warehouse DSN: postgresql://kasax_svc:qKMoO2AkuKwZ23@db-b256.kelviio.example:5432/framir

Subject: Key rotation for Plannerly diagnostics service

Team,

While investigating the query planner regression in Plannerly 4.2, we discovered the diagnostics collector was still using a key issued before the credential policy change. That key is now revoked. All traces gathered with it remain valid, but future maintainers should note that replaying the regression suite requires the new credential. The replacement key for the internal diagnostics endpoint is provided immediately below.

service key, bajog-yahop: kto7_mMHVCpJ